AVEVA™ Operations Management Interface

Set the pane presentation style

Content in a layout can be shown by three pane presentation styles

  • Single

    In Single mode, the pane hosts a single content item (Layout, Display, or Graphic) shown during runtime. Single is the default pane presentation style.

  • Multiple

    In Multiple mode, two or more content items are added to a multi-content pane by a script or a navigation API. Each content item is placed in a separate pane. During runtime, the user cannot select an item from Multiple panes. A script or navigation API controls the ordering of the panes within the stack. The content in the top most pane is visible during runtime.

  • Tabbed

    In Tabbed mode, two or more content items are added to a multi-content pane. Each content item is placed in a separate tabbed pane. During runtime, the user selects a tab to show its content in the pane.

When you change a pane's presentation style from Single to either Multiple or Tabbed, any existing content in the pane is maintained. However, when you change the presentation style from Multiple or Tabbed to Single, you see a confirmation message that all content except the current selection in the action list will be removed from the pane.

To set the presentation style of a pane

  1. Open the layout from the Visualization folder.

  2. Select the pane to set a presentation style for.

  3. Select the Presentation Style selector at the top left corner of the selected pane.

  4. Select a presentation style from the list.

    The icon shown in the Presentation Style selector changes to match the presentation style you selected.

  5. Select Save to save your changes.
